Start with the fact that reframes everything else. By the middle of 2026, a run of independent citation studies had reached the same conclusion from different data sets: YouTube is the single most-cited domain in Google's AI Overviews. Not a top-ten source — the top source, ranking ahead of Wikipedia, ahead of national health authorities, ahead of every news publisher. The precise share depends on who is counting and how, and the estimates genuinely diverge — some analyses put YouTube around a fifth of all AI Overview citations, others closer to a quarter or higher, with one BrightEdge measurement near 29.5%. Treat the exact percentage as contested and the direction as settled: when Google's AI composes an answer, video is the source it reaches for most, and YouTube is where that video lives.
That is a strange thing to sit next to the usual creator anxiety about AI, which is mostly about AI Overviews eating organic clicks and answer engines summarizing your work without sending anyone back. Both are true at once. AI answers are pulling traffic away from text pages and, on the same results, citing YouTube more than any written source on the web. The question that follows is not whether video belongs in AI search — the data settled that — but why so few creators are actually capturing the citations that video is clearly winning. That is the real gap, and it is not the one the headline describes.
The most useful finding of 2026 was not that YouTube gets cited. It was what does and does not predict a citation. The largest study of the year — over 100 million AI citation instances across ChatGPT, Google AI Overviews, Google AI Mode, Perplexity, Copilot, and Gemini, published in early March 2026 — measured the relationship between a video's performance metrics and how often AI cited it. The correlations were essentially zero. View count landed at roughly negative-0.03. Likes, channel subscribers, and total channel views all sat in the same statistical nowhere. Popularity, the thing every creator is trained to maximize, has no measurable bearing on whether an AI answer references your video.
The concrete version of that is more striking than the coefficient. Around 40% of the videos AI cited had fewer than a thousand views at the time they were cited. About a third of the cited channels had fewer than ten thousand subscribers. The median cited channel was small and specific, not a mega-channel. As the study put it, AI citation behaves less like recommendation and more like reference selection: the system is not surfacing the popular video, it is selecting the video that best and most legibly answers the query, and it does not care how many people watched it. This is the same shift away from popularity-as-proxy that is remaking how AI search picks sources — the engine reads for the answer, not the crowd.
If views are noise, what is signal? Three things showed up consistently. The first is a real transcript — captioned, accurate audio the model can actually read, because an AI cannot cite what it cannot parse, and a video with a clean transcript is a document the system can quote from. The second is descriptive metadata: video description length showed a weak-but-real positive correlation with repeated citation, and recency did too, meaning fresh, well-described videos on a specific topic get pulled more than stale ones. The third is chapter structure. Timestamped videos punch above their weight — in the study, a large majority of timestamped videos earned multiple citations from a single upload, because each well-labeled chapter becomes its own citable answer to its own query. Yet roughly 69% of cited videos had no timestamp structure at all, which means the multiplication effect is sitting unused for most of the library. The content formats that actually get cited reward the same discipline in video that they reward in text: a clear, well-structured answer to a specific question beats a long, unstructured one aimed at a broad topic.
There is a platform split underneath the YouTube story that most single-number headlines flatten, and it changes the strategy completely. YouTube citations are not spread evenly across AI search — they are concentrated. In the 2026 study, the platforms that actually cite YouTube were Perplexity (the single largest at around 38.7% of YouTube citations), Google AI Overviews (around 36.6%), and Google AI Mode (around 19.6%). Everything else was a rounding error: ChatGPT at roughly 4.4%, Microsoft Copilot at around 0.5%, and Gemini at about 0.2%. Copilot and Gemini, two of the most-used AI assistants in the world, essentially do not cite video.
Read that as a map of where video works and where it does not. If your entire content presence is video, you are strongly positioned on Google's AI Overviews and AI Mode and on Perplexity — and effectively absent from the answer engines that reach for text instead. If your entire presence is text, the reverse: you can be cited in Gemini and Copilot and on the text side of every engine, but you are ceding the surface where YouTube is the most-cited domain on the web. Neither pure strategy covers the field. One more split sits inside YouTube itself. Citations do not spread evenly across video formats either — roughly 94% of YouTube citations in the study went to long-form videos, with Shorts earning only around 5.7% and other formats a sliver. Long-form carries the denser transcript, the fuller description, and the chapter structure that make a video citable, and it is far more likely to contain a self-contained answer to a search query than a fifteen-second clip. Worse for Shorts, what citations they do earn concentrate almost entirely inside Google's own surfaces — they are close to invisible on Perplexity and the rest. That does not make Shorts worthless; they remain a reach-and-discovery engine, which is the whole point of the Shorts-versus-long-form funnel. It means Shorts and long-form do different jobs: Shorts win the algorithmic feed, long-form wins the citation.
Put the three gaps together and a specific opening appears. Video is the most-cited source in the largest AI search surface. The videos that get cited are chosen for structure and topic fit, not popularity, so a small, precise channel can win citations a large sloppy one cannot. And because video is cited in some engines and text in others, the creators who cover both formats are cited across the whole field while single-format creators are cited on half of it. Almost nobody is set up to exploit all three at once, because it requires producing structured long-form video and the matching text and publishing both, consistently, onto the surfaces that cite each — which is a production problem, not an insight problem.
That production problem is the actual barrier, and it is why this reads as a distribution opportunity rather than a checklist. The winning move is legible: film or generate a focused long-form video with a clean transcript, a real description, and chapters; publish it to YouTube where AI Overviews and Perplexity will cite it; then repurpose the same argument into a blog post, a set of social posts, and a newsletter so you also appear on Gemini, Copilot, and the text side of every engine.
